About N-[(1-ethylpyrazol-4-yl)methyl]-N-methyl-2-(2,4,7-trimethyl-1H-indol-3-yl)acetamide
N-[(1-ethylpyrazol-4-yl)methyl]-N-methyl-2-(2,4,7-trimethyl-1H-indol-3-yl)acetamide (PubChem CID 70788742) has the molecular formula C20H26N4O
and a molecular weight of 338.46 g/mol. Its IUPAC name is N-[(1-ethylpyrazol-4-yl)methyl]-N-methyl-2-(2,4,7-trimethyl-1H-indol-3-yl)acetamide.

What is the SMILES notation for N-[(1-ethylpyrazol-4-yl)methyl]-N-methyl-2-(2,4,7-trimethyl-1H-indol-3-yl)acetamide?
The canonical SMILES for N-[(1-ethylpyrazol-4-yl)methyl]-N-methyl-2-(2,4,7-trimethyl-1H-indol-3-yl)acetamide is CCn1cc(CN(C)C(=O)Cc2c(C)[nH]c3c(C)ccc(C)c23)cn1.
What is the InChIKey of N-[(1-ethylpyrazol-4-yl)methyl]-N-methyl-2-(2,4,7-trimethyl-1H-indol-3-yl)acetamide?
The InChIKey is AKJNJSBRHHNTAE-UHFFFAOYSA-N. The full InChI is InChI=1S/C20H26N4O/c1-6-24-12-16(10-21-24)11-23(5)18(25)9-17-15(4)22-20-14(3)8-7-13(2)19(17)20/h7-8,10,12,22H,6,9,11H2,1-5H3.
What are the key properties of N-[(1-ethylpyrazol-4-yl)methyl]-N-methyl-2-(2,4,7-trimethyl-1H-indol-3-yl)acetamide?
N-[(1-ethylpyrazol-4-yl)methyl]-N-methyl-2-(2,4,7-trimethyl-1H-indol-3-yl)acetamide has a molecular weight of 338.46 g/mol, XLogP of 3.51, 5 rotatable bonds, 1 hydrogen bond donors, and 3 hydrogen bond acceptors.
